Understanding Pre-made Audio Cables

Pre-made audio cables are mass-produced cables manufactured to standard lengths and specifications in controlled factory environments. These cables typically undergo rigorous quality testing before distribution, ensuring consistent performance across large production batches. For commercial installations requiring quick deployment, pre-made options like microphone cables and instrument cables offer immediate availability from distributors. The standardized nature of pre-made cables simplifies inventory management for installation companies maintaining stock for recurring project types.

Pre-made cables follow industry-standard specifications established by organizations such as the International Organization for Standardization, which ensures compatibility across equipment brands and models. This standardization reduces the risk of connector mismatches and signal compatibility issues during installation. However, pre-made cables come in fixed lengths, which may result in excess cable management challenges or insufficient reach in complex installations.

Understanding Custom Audio Cables

Custom audio cables are purpose-built to exact specifications required by a specific installation project, including precise lengths, connector types, and shielding requirements. These cables are typically manufactured after receiving detailed specifications from the installation team, allowing for perfect fitting in unique architectural spaces. Custom solutions excel in permanent commercial installations where aesthetics and optimal cable routing take priority over quick deployment.

The custom cable manufacturing process allows for specialized configurations such as flat cables designed for under-carpet routing or discrete wall installations. Installation professionals can specify exact conductor gauges, shielding types, and jacket materials based on the environmental conditions of the installation site. This flexibility makes custom cables particularly valuable for museums, theaters, and corporate AV installations where cable visibility must be minimized.

Cost Comparison: Pre-made vs Custom Audio Cables

Pre-made audio cables typically offer lower per-unit costs for standard applications due to economies of scale in mass production. For small to medium commercial installations requiring common cable types like ethernet cables for digital audio networks, the cost advantage of pre-made options is significant. Installation budgets can be reduced by selecting pre-made cables when project specifications align with standard product offerings.

Custom audio cables involve higher upfront manufacturing costs due to setup fees and lower production volumes. However, custom cables eliminate waste from excess cable length, which can offset initial costs in large-scale installations. When calculating total cost of ownership, factors such as installation labor time, cable management hardware, and potential reconfiguration needs should be included. For long-term installations with stable system configurations, custom cables may prove more economical over the equipment lifecycle.

Lead Time and Project Timeline Considerations

Pre-made cables offer significant advantages in project scheduling due to immediate availability from distributors and manufacturers. Commercial installation projects with tight deadlines can benefit from pre-made cable inventory, reducing waiting periods that could delay system commissioning. This availability is particularly valuable for emergency replacements, temporary installations, and projects with compressed construction schedules.

Custom cable production typically requires lead times ranging from several days to several weeks depending on order complexity and manufacturer capacity. Installation teams must account for these lead times during project planning phases to avoid scheduling conflicts. Quality Control and Reliability Factors

Pre-made cables manufactured under controlled conditions typically exhibit consistent quality across production batches. Factory testing protocols identify defects before products reach customers, reducing the risk of installation failures. Commercial installers can reference manufacturer specifications with confidence when specifying pre-made cables for projects requiring predictable performance characteristics.

Custom cables allow for quality specifications tailored to specific installation requirements, including enhanced shielding for electrically noisy environments or rugged jackets for high-traffic areas. Installation teams can specify higher-grade components when project budgets permit, potentially exceeding the quality of standard pre-made alternatives. The ability to verify manufacturing processes through direct communication with custom cable suppliers provides additional quality assurance for critical installations.

Flexibility and Installation Adaptability

Pre-made cables offer limited flexibility in terms of length customization and connector options, which may create challenges in non-standard installation layouts. However, pre-made cables with common configurations like DMX cables for lighting control systems provide proven reliability in typical installation scenarios. Installation teams can combine multiple pre-made cables using couplers when exact lengths are unavailable, though this approach introduces additional connection points.

Custom cables excel in installations requiring unusual routing paths, specific connector configurations, or integration with existing infrastructure. When installing audio systems in historic buildings or adaptive reuse spaces, custom cables can be engineered to navigate architectural constraints while maintaining signal integrity. The flexibility of custom solutions supports innovative installation approaches that would be impractical with pre-made cable constraints.

Frequently Asked Questions

Q: How do I determine the right cable length for my commercial installation?

A: Measure the exact routing path between connection points, adding 10-15% for slack and management loops. For pre-made cables, select the next standard length above your measurement. For custom cables, provide exact measurements plus routing allowances.

Q: Can I mix pre-made and custom cables in the same installation?

A: Yes, hybrid installations are common and practical. Use pre-made cables for standard connections and custom cables for unique routing requirements, ensuring consistent quality standards across the system.

Q: What warranty coverage should I expect from commercial cable suppliers?

A: Reputable suppliers typically offer warranties ranging from one to five years, with coverage for manufacturing defects affecting signal transmission or physical durability.

Q: How do I ensure signal quality in long cable runs for commercial installations?

A: Select appropriate cable gauges for your run lengths, use signal boosters or extenders when necessary, and ensure proper shielding for the installation environment’s electromagnetic conditions.

Q: What factors increase custom cable costs beyond basic specifications?

A: Premium connector brands, specialized shielding materials, weather-resistant jackets, custom colors for aesthetic matching, and expedited manufacturing timelines all contribute to higher custom cable costs.
